Here is the Rights Guide for Girls and Youth with Creative Genders. It aims to support young people in learning about their basic rights, from a feminist and intersectional perspective.
The Rights Guide is free. It focuses on practices that promote equality in ways that are youth friendly. It contains writing spaces, quizzes, and “comics you’re the hero” that enliven and support reading.
The guide is filled with cartoons and illustrations, most of which are inspired by the experiences of young people who attend the Girls’ Centre’s youth activities.
Target age: 10 to 15 years old
Original illustrations by Sophie Bédard
Texts by Anne-Sophie Trottier
